The Circular Relationship of Dua and Iman
Making dua is essential for strengthening one’s iman as it creates a reciprocal relationship; strong iman leads to more sincere dua, while more dua in turn fortifies iman. This cyclical connection highlights that those with weak iman can enhance their belief through the practice of dua. When individuals engage in dua, they inherently affirm their belief in Allah's existence, power, and mercy, which reflects a deep internal state of faith and assurance. This act of supplication becomes a manifestation of worship that reinforces both their immediate relationship with Allah and their overall spiritual growth.
